How do you keep mashed potatoes from getting stringy?

Here's how to keep mashed potatoes from getting stringy:

1. Choose the Right Potatoes:

* Starchy potatoes: Russet, Idaho, and Yukon Gold are ideal for fluffy mashed potatoes. They have a high starch content, which contributes to a smooth texture.

* Avoid waxy potatoes: Red Bliss, Fingerling, and New Potatoes are waxy and will make your mashed potatoes sticky and gummy.

2. Cook Potatoes Correctly:

* Boil until fork-tender: Don't overcook them, as this can break down the potato cells and lead to stringiness. You want them to be soft but not mushy.

* Don't overcrowd the pot: Overcrowding will make the potatoes cook unevenly and can cause them to stick together.

* Drain well: Thoroughly drain the potatoes and shake them in the colander to remove excess water.

3. Mash Gently:

* Use a potato ricer or food mill: These tools break down the potatoes without overworking them.

* Hand mash: If you're using a hand masher, do it gently and avoid over-mixing.

* Electric mixer: If using an electric mixer, use the lowest speed and be careful not to whip too much air into the potatoes.

4. Add Liquids Sparingly:

* Start with warm milk or cream: This helps to make the potatoes creamy without adding too much liquid.

* Add gradually: Add a small amount of liquid at a time and mix thoroughly until the desired consistency is reached.

5. Avoid Over-Mixing:
